The Bullpadel Ionic Control 2023 is a carefully constructed control tool for the medium-to-advanced player who wants to dictate rallies through precision and effect rather than pace. The Glaphite surface — Bullpadel's proprietary blend of carbon and glassfibre — adds just enough flex to keep ball contact feeling connected without sacrificing the structural rigidity that advanced players need for consistent placement. The 3D Grain rough finish is a genuine differentiator, giving real grip on the ball for players who generate a lot of spin and work the angles. At a midpoint weight of around 370g with a low balance, it sits comfortably in the hand over long matches without punishing the arm. This is an ideal racket for the back-court player who wants to outthink opponents rather than overpower them.

The Ionic Control is a round, low-balance racket aimed squarely at medium-to-advanced players who prioritise placement, consistency, and effect over raw power. Its dual-density MultiEVA core and Glaphite surface blend carbon rigidity with glassfibre flex to deliver a forgiving but technically rewarding tool.
- Players who rely on ball placement and effect will find the 3D Grain rough-textured face gives them noticeably more grip on the ball, making it easier to generate spin and disguise direction from the back court.
- The dual-density MultiEVA core — softer on the inside, firmer on the outside — gives the racket a distinctive feel that cushions defensive retrieves without killing the energy needed to redirect pace from the glass.
- Manoeuvring this racket through quick exchanges feels natural thanks to the low balance point, reducing rotational swing weight and keeping the hand comfortable during extended defensive sessions.
- Aggressive net players who want to put points away with flat, powerful smashes will find this racket's round shape, low balance, and control-oriented construction leave them wanting considerably more punchthrough and leverage overhead.
